To work as a day shift Certified Nursing Assistant in Nashville, a valid CNA license is mandatory. Additional local certifications aren't typically required, but having experience in long-term or skilled nursing care can enhance your eligibility and readiness for this role.
Day shift CNAs often start with patient assessments, assisting with hygiene, feeding, and mobility. They collaborate with nursing staff to ensure care plans are executed, while also monitoring patient comfort and reporting changes during the daytime hours.
Certified Nursing Assistants working day shifts can pursue advancement through additional certifications, such as becoming a Licensed Practical Nurse, or specialize in areas like geriatric care. Employers often support continued education, opening paths to more skilled nursing roles.
